Satellite Orbital Period Calculator

Period of a circular orbit from altitude (Kepler's 3rd).

Compute the orbital period of a satellite in a circular orbit around a chosen body (Earth, Moon, Mars) from its altitude above the surface using Kepler's third law.

Formula

T = 2π · √(a³ / (G · M)), a = R_body + altitude.
